Solution for 2(n-4)+5=3(n+1) equation:


Simplifying
2(n + -4) + 5 = 3(n + 1)

Reorder the terms:
2(-4 + n) + 5 = 3(n + 1)
(-4 * 2 + n * 2) + 5 = 3(n + 1)
(-8 + 2n) + 5 = 3(n + 1)

Reorder the terms:
-8 + 5 + 2n = 3(n + 1)

Combine like terms: -8 + 5 = -3
-3 + 2n = 3(n + 1)

Reorder the terms:
-3 + 2n = 3(1 + n)
-3 + 2n = (1 * 3 + n * 3)
-3 + 2n = (3 + 3n)

Solving
-3 + 2n = 3 + 3n

Solving for variable 'n'.

Move all terms containing n to the left, all other terms to the right.

Add '-3n' to each side of the equation.
-3 + 2n + -3n = 3 + 3n + -3n

Combine like terms: 2n + -3n = -1n
-3 + -1n = 3 + 3n + -3n

Combine like terms: 3n + -3n = 0
-3 + -1n = 3 + 0
-3 + -1n = 3

Add '3' to each side of the equation.
-3 + 3 + -1n = 3 + 3

Combine like terms: -3 + 3 = 0
0 + -1n = 3 + 3
-1n = 3 + 3

Combine like terms: 3 + 3 = 6
-1n = 6

Divide each side by '-1'.
n = -6

Simplifying
n = -6
